Hi I have a problem with my KA. it's an X reg....

It has just failed it's MOT on:

1. Offside rear (outer sill) Subframe mounting prescribed area is excessively corroded.

2. Offside front (member) Subframe mounting prescribed area is excessively corroded.

Anybody know how this could be fixed via garage?? How much this could cost me? And how I could prevent that happening again?

Any help greatly appreciated.

Thanks

ask the garage that done the mot for a price as it's a welding job & it can be done

i would shop around for some prices as they tend to vary but do it quick as

the mot needs to be re-done withing 10 days i think & the garage that done the mot will

only charge you a partial re-test

They couldn't give me a definite answer because they don't know how far the rust has got to. They could give a rough quote but it could be more or less! They could give me the basic but that would't include any of the extra support welding that may have to be done!

With the Max budget.... I haven't told them the exact amount that I've got available.... I've given them a figure @ least 100 below what I could afford (just to cover myself!!!!!!).

I've had a nose under the car myself today.... there is quite a bit of rust along the part where you 'jack up' the car to change a tyre.... and there are two holes near the rear end of the car :S So depending on how rusted those holes are it could be a whole panel or just a small area to fill the holes in.

But I have told them..... if it'll cost more than what I've said to phone me n I'll leave the MOT n sell it for scrap!

okay ive done a few of these rust buckets and ill be honest they cant estimate as until they strip the interior carpets and start cutting the rust out they have no idea how bad bad really is ive done a few and i can tell you now expect at least 400 quid to have it done properly these areas on the ka always rust and quite badly basically the carpets inside the car have to come out then the strengthening panel on the floor which is like hardebned underseal has to be chipped off and its a pain to do or it catches fire then the rust has to be cut out then it has to be oxy acetelene welded afetr its been grinded and prepped the welding has to be done in and outside the car then grinded and fully undersealed etc if im honest if its that bad and the rust takes up more then an inch by an inch scrap it as the weldoing can extend to the sills and to the engine bay bare in mind at the price i qouted that was cheap and far more needed welded than what we thought but its a slippery slope im afraid
